Uncommon Activities to Unwind After a Stressful Job

To refresh your mind, consider trying some uncommon activities. These hobbies not only offer relaxation but also spark creativity. Here are a few unique options:

  1. Pottery: Shaping clay can be very therapeutic. It helps you focus on the moment and forget about daily stressors. Plus, you get to create something beautiful with your own hands.

  2. Bird Watching: This hobby encourages you to spend time outdoors. Observing birds can be peaceful and gives you a chance to connect with nature. Grab some binoculars and find a local park or nature reserve.

  3. Aerial Yoga: If you want to try something physically engaging, aerial yoga might be for you. It combines yoga with acrobatics, allowing you to stretch and strengthen your body while having fun. It’s a great way to break from the typical workout routine.

  4. Scrapbooking: This creative outlet allows you to preserve memories while expressing your artistic side. Gather photos, stickers, and other materials to create a visual diary of special moments.

  5. Gardening: Tending to plants can be a great stress reliever. It offers physical activity and a connection to the earth. Plus, watching your plants grow can provide a sense of achievement.

These activities are more than just fun; they help you unwind after a busy day. Engaging in something new can lift your spirits and bring joy back into your life. Remember, it’s not about being perfect at a hobby; it’s about enjoying the process.

Making Time for Yourself: Practical Tips for Busy Moms

Finding time for hobbies can be challenging, but it’s essential. Here are some practical tips to help busy moms carve out time for themselves:

  1. Set Boundaries: Let your family know when you need “me time.” This can help create a supportive environment where everyone respects your hobby time.

  2. Involve Family: Consider hobbies that the whole family can enjoy. For example, hiking can be a fun way to spend time together while getting exercise.

  3. Start Small: If your schedule is tight, try dedicating just 15-30 minutes a few times a week to your hobby. Gradually increase your time as it becomes part of your routine.

  4. Use Downtime Wisely: Turn idle moments into hobby time. If you’re waiting for an appointment, bring along a book or some knitting.

  5. Schedule It: Treat your hobby like an important meeting. Block out time in your calendar specifically for your interests.
